Mr Ubani, a former chairman of the Ikeja branch of the NBA in Lagos who later served a term as the second vice president of the association at the national level, explained that his son, who is also a lawyer and an eligible voter, experienced similar difficulties, while several colleagues and friends contacted him during the election to report comparable problems.

Reactions continue to trail the just concluded 2026 national officers’ election of the Nigerian Bar Association (NBA), with Monday Ubani, a Senior Advocate of Nigeria (SAN), calling for a comprehensive review of the exercise which was characterised by controversies, including technical failures that reportedly prevented several eligible lawyers from voting.

Billed to be inaugurated alongside other newly elected national officers during the NBA’s annual general conference scheduled for 21 to 28 August in Port Harcourt, Rivers State, Mrs Badejo-Okusanya will take office as the association’s 33rd president and the first female to occupy the office through an election.
